Summary
Decides to extend the present mandate of the UN Interim Force in Lebanon for a further interim period of 6 months, that is, until 19 Jan. 1987; reiterates its strong support for the territorial integrity, sovereignty and independence of Lebanon within its internationally recognized boundaries.
